Output 3ae845a2f47a0efc8983d4158ec97bb701d5f31dc9266a587e7a6131d5a79653:1

value
43991302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a58c516854314ad3a7e43f7332b5f65de48063d OP_EQUAL
address
MPRsSt1uUDpGg7qMDviUXTft4ccbqHNS6y
transaction
3ae845a2f47a0efc8983d4158ec97bb701d5f31dc9266a587e7a6131d5a79653
spent
true